610151104 -
Virginia Panel Corporation
This insert contains 8 right-angle VTAC high speed contacts and is designed to mount directly to a PCB as part of the Infinity Connector system. It is used in the 90 Series SIM Module and occupies 1 of the 34 slots in this module. Available in a set with VTAC pass-thru insert as 610151106. 40-630-022-32/2 -
Pickering Interfaces Ltd.
The 40-630 series of general purpose multiplexer modules feature a wide range of switching configurations. Typical applications include signal routing in ATE and data acquisition systems.Each module is configured into one of the configuration modes. Connections are made via a front panel 68-pin connector. Available reed relay formats are 1-pole, 2-pole and 1-pole screened.
